Default Water Cooling - Fans + Thermal Paste Question

I have recently bought a Asetek 120mm Water Cooling Kit, exatly the same as a Corsair H50.

It never came with fitting instructions. And got a few questions

#1. It looks like it already has thermal paste on the heat skink, but i bought some Diamond thermal paste thinking it didn't. Am i right in thinking this IS thermal paste? And if so, i cant apply my diamond paste (Which would be better?) unless i whipe off the existing stuff?

#2. How do i go about fitting the fan? should it be something like. Radiator, Fan, and fan against case? so its SUCKING the hot air hot, or blowing the cool air in? (This is the bit i'm a bit confused on)

First off, its usually cheap crap thats already on the cooler mate, clean it off with come nail varnish remover, apply the new thermal paste (about the size of a grain of rice, any more will only insulate the cpu and make it hotter)
